Pagasa: Cloudy Sunday with rain showers in many parts of PH due to LPA

MANILA, Philippines — A low pressure area (LPA) off Surigao Del Sur will bring rain to many parts of the country on Sunday, according to the Philippine Atmospheric, Geophysical and Astronomical Services Administration (Pagasa).

Pagasa weather specialist Benizon Estareja said the LPA was spotted 195 kilometers east of Hinatuan, Surigao Del Sur.

“Dahil sa LPA maulap na rin po ang kalangitan dito sa malaking bahagi ng Visayas and even Caraga region. Sasamahan ‘yan ngayong araw ng kalat kalat na pagulan at light to moderate rains,” said Estareja.

(Due to the LPA, cloudy skies and scattered rain showers will prevail in many parts of the Visayas and Caraga region in Mindanao.)

Cloudy skies and scattered rain showers in the afternoon and evening are likewise expected inSouthern Luzon, particularly the Bicol and Calabarzon (Cavite, Laguna, Batangas, Rizal, Quezon) regions and the provinces of Marinduque and Romblon due to the LPA’s trough or extension  

“Mababa ang tiyansa na ang LPA ay magiging isang bagyo, ngunit nakikita natin na tatawarin nito ang sa susunod na dalawang araw ang ating bansa,” said Estareja.

(The LPA has a slim chance of intensifying into a storm, but it is expected to cross the country in the next two days.)

Despite the presence of an LPA, no gale warning is in effect over the country’s seaboards.
